Karen Qiu
They provide parking, which is rare in this area from my experience! There were so many options to pick from when it came to drinks and food. I got the chicken fajitas, which were priced reasonably and really good! It was fresh, flavorful, and came with a good amount of sauce(separate). I also got the iced Twix latte, which was a good blend of flavors, but was(in my opinion) too sweet, little to no coffeand not enough ice since it was a bit warm still. If I had asked for slightly less sweet, it would have been perfect. The atmosphere is where this place shines. There is a comforting feel with how this place is decorated(theres a huge wall of photos dedicated to furry visitors), and while a little cramped, doesnt feel as such when you sit down with how its formatted. I am a bit concerned if I were to bring my dog though, as navigating around tables are very hard since the place is relatively small and he could be stepped on if its slightly busier. Its not too loud, even when it is very busy, and the baristas are very nice. Its a cute place to sit down and work for a bit as a student.
